Determining the optimum digestible isoleucine to lysine ratio for Ross 708 x Ross YP male broilers from 0 to 18 d of age
SUMMARY: Continuous genetic improvement of high yielding broiler strains necessitates reevaluation of amino acid requirements. The objective of this study was to evaluate the dIle requirement of Ross 708 x Ross YP male broilers from d 0 to 18. Experimental diets were created from a common deficient...
